Determine to Sing a New Song
Psalm 144:9
God, I will sing a new song to you; I will play on a ten-stringed harp for You–
In this psalm, David is crying out for deliverance from his enemies through praise. He vows to sing a new song to God in response to His deliverance. Apparently, David has learned something through this experience, and he is determined to give God the glory for it.
